Cairngorms Wildfire Threat Reaches Critical Level Following Wind Shift

Emergency authorities have declared a major incident status in response to escalating Cairngorms wildfire threat conditions. The declaration comes as meteorological conditions shift dramatically, with forecasted wind changes creating heightened risk of rapid fire expansion across the highland region.

Immediate Evacuation Protocol Implemented

The complete evacuation of Nethy Bridge residents represents one of the most significant precautionary measures implemented in the area. Local emergency services coordinated the removal of all inhabitants from the village as a preventative measure against potential fire advancement. The evacuation order reflects the severity assessment by incident commanders monitoring the spreading flames.

Authorities emphasized that the evacuation process prioritized resident safety while maintaining orderly movement from affected zones. Emergency personnel provided guidance and support throughout the relocation procedure, ensuring vulnerable populations received adequate assistance during the departure.

Wind Pattern Changes Amplify Fire Propagation Risk

Meteorological forecasts indicate significant atmospheric changes that could substantially increase the Cairngorms wildfire threat trajectory. Wind direction modifications previously predicted would channel airflows directly toward populated settlements, thereby accelerating potential flame advancement. These meteorological shifts fundamentally altered emergency response strategies and resource allocation decisions.

The interaction between wind patterns and terrain features in the Cairngorms creates complex fire behavior conditions. Elevated regions and valley formations can funnel winds in unpredictable directions, complicating efforts to contain and control advancing fire lines.

Understanding Wildfire Risk Assessment

Fire behavior specialists continuously evaluate multiple variables when determining Cairngorms wildfire threat levels. Fuel moisture content, temperature gradients, relative humidity levels, and wind velocity combine to create hazard indices that inform emergency response protocols. The declaration of major incident status signified that current parameters exceeded established thresholds for standard management procedures.

Historical fire patterns in Scottish highland regions demonstrate how rapidly conditions can deteriorate when atmospheric variables align unfavorably. Previous incidents provided valuable data informing current predictive models and resource positioning strategies.
